The Armed Forces of Ukraine lost positions around Bakhmut: Russian forces are advancing on Chasiv Yar

According to our source in the General Staff, the Armed Forces of Ukraine have suffered serious losses, losing almost all of their positions, which they successfully restored in the summer, around Bakhmut. The situation in the region is becoming increasingly difficult, and now fighting is actively taking place around Chasiv Yar, which was previously considered a strategic point for the Ukrainian army. The new leadership faces a difficult task of holding strategic cities in eastern Ukraine, especially given the limited reserves of the Armed Forces. The Armed Forces of the Russian Federation have intensified attacks in the Chasiv Yar area in the Donetsk region. This information was confirmed by BILD Deputy Editor-in-Chief Paul Ronzheimer. He emphasized that Chasiv Yar is the next city that the occupiers are trying to capture. Russian drones used in this area are a particular threat. Due to the deterioration of weather conditions - clouds, snow and rain, the situation is safer, but still, drone attacks remain constant. The military emphasizes that the attacks have become more intense since the beginning of the last few days and may intensify even more in the coming weeks. “So this city could be the next to suffer destruction similar to Bakhmut. It is obvious that the Russians have the advantage, and they are advancing westward, meter by meter,” Rontzheimer noted. Earlier it was reported that the occupiers approached Chasovye Yar in the Donetsk region to a distance of approximately 5-7 kilometers. The Russian Federation continues intensive offensive actions in the Kupyansk and Bakhmut directions and is regrouping in Limansk.
